Output e2a3c30d37db80ee12e404136ef9727805a2e97224c6f0ace24aec5d7ac6b005:1

value
893388320
script pubkey
OP_0 OP_PUSHBYTES_20 c51357739848f0a3492ef7b1b4be442686470ba8
address
bc1qc5f4wuucfrc2xjfw77cmf0jyy6rywzagg3y8ws
transaction
e2a3c30d37db80ee12e404136ef9727805a2e97224c6f0ace24aec5d7ac6b005
confirmations
399524
spent
true